Don't Forget to Turn Off Energies



In case of a calamity, specifically if you reside in a flood-prone area, it would certainly be suggested to shut off the primary electrical circuit. This removes power to your entire home, avoiding electrical shocks when water comes in as it is a conductor. Don't forget to transform off the primary water line valve. When floodwaters are high, furniture will certainly move and cause damages. Having the major valve shut down stops further damages.

Do Take Notice Of Tiny Leakages



A ruptured pipe doesn't take place over night. Normally, there are red flags that indicate you have deteriorated pipes in your house. For instance, you might see bubbling paint, peeling wallpaper, water streaks, water stains, or leaking sounds behind the wall surfaces. At some point, this pipe will break. Ideally, you need to not wait for points to rise. Have your plumbing fixed prior to it causes substantial damages.

Do Not Panic in Case of a Ruptured Pipe



When it comes to water damages, timing is essential. Hence, if a pipe ruptureds in your house, right away closed off your major water valve to reduce off the resource. Call a reputable water damages remediation specialist for support.

Some Do's & Don't When Dealing with a Water Damage


DO:




  • Make sure the water source has been eliminated. Contact a plumber if needed.


  • Turn off circuit breakers supplying electricity to wet areas and unplug any electronics that are on wet carpet or surfaces


  • Remove small furniture items


  • Remove as much excess water as possible by mopping or blotting; Use WHITE towels to blot wet carpeting


  • Wipe water from wooden furniture after removing anything on it


  • Remove and prop up wet upholstery cushions for even drying (check for any bleeding)


  • Pin up curtains or furniture skirts if needed


  • Place aluminum foil, saucers or wood blocks between furniture legs and wet carpet


  • Turn on air conditioning for maximum drying in winter and open windows in the summer


  • Open any drawers and cabinets affected for complete drying but do not force them open


  • Remove any valuable art objects or paintings to a safe, dry place


  • Open any suitcases or luggage that may have been affected to dry, preferably in sunlight


  • Hang any fur or leather goods to dry at room temperature


  • Punch small holes in sagging ceilings to relieve trapped water (don't forget to place pans beneath!); however, if the ceiling is sagging extremely low, stay out of the room and we'll take care of it

  • DO NOT:


  • Leave wet fabrics in place; dry them as soon as possible


  • Leave books, magazines or any other colored items on wet carpets or floor


  • Use your household vacuum to remove water


  • Use TV's or other electronics/appliances while standing on wet carpets or floors; especially not on wet concrete floors


  • Turn on ceiling fixtures if the ceiling is wet


  • Turn your heat up, unless instructed otherwise
